Subject: [Vantage] crystal Report Distribution
Could someone let me know the outcome of the debate on the best way to
give users access to specific reports in Crystal?
Do Crystal and ODBC need to be installed on each work station?
Where should I set up shortcuts to each report? etc

If the report uses ODBC to connect to data the client PC will also need an
ODBC connection (such as Merrant's for Progress). If the report uses only
.dbf files as created by Vantage (such as for Job Traveler, PO, Invoice,
etc...) then the client PC will not need any ODBC connector. The .dbf files
get placed on user's PC in the local vntgwork folder.
Crystal (depending on version) has a report distributor that makes a
portable version for non-Crystal PCs. In V8 you have to download the
distributor from Seagate. Segate is also discouraging it in favor of web
distribution of reports which sounds like a lot more work to me and involves
having to set up a web server internally. The report distributor has been
very easy to use. I created Favorites items on Vantage screen pointing to
the .exe files created on the user's PC. Only hassle has been re-loading on
each PC when changes are made.

Everything Todd has said here is correct. I would like to add that even if you are using the .dbf files, the user will need to run whatever report is being used in Vantage first to update the .dbf files. Otherwise, that user will always receive the same report.
In my opinion, the web is the best way to distribute reports. It can be a hassle to setup, but it is well worth the effort. Don't be afraid to call Seagate Support to ask for help. They will walk you through whatever you need.
A second choice would be to download the PDF writer beta from Seagate. The KB article is at http://support.seagatesoftware.com/library/kbase/articles/c2006248.asp
and the file is located at
http://support.seagatesoftware.com/communityCS/FilesAndUpdates/scr8-pdfexportdriver.zip.asp
The PDF is a good choice for distributing reports, because it shows the report exactly as Crystal would. No other export can do this. Plus the users can't change any of the information. Which may or may not be what you want.
